gpt4 book ai didi

c# - 成为 "the real administrator"(Windows) 并在 .NET C# 中执行真正的管理任务?

转载 作者:可可西里 更新时间:2023-11-01 10:50:29 27 4
gpt4 key购买 nike

在 Windows 中,仅仅因为您的帐户在 Administrators 组中并不意味着它有足够的特权可以删除一些 系统文件。有没有一种方法可以在 C# 中使用这种“最高”管理员权限执行操作,而无需登录管理员帐户(仅使用管理员组中的帐户)。

编辑

在我的情况下,这是一个个人应用程序(很抱歉我没有指定)并且我相信自己不会删除任何系统文件或给予任何流氓病毒访问此权限的权限。我在个人电脑上使用域帐户,虽然我在我的个人电脑上有管理员权限,但我不想在用户之间切换。我想要的是一种以尽可能高的特权用户身份运行我的程序的简单方法。除非以完全管理员身份登录,否则没有任何办法吗?

最佳答案

问题已回答谢谢。我被告知无法像在 Linux 中使用 sudo 命令那样以 FULL 管理员权限启动应用程序。添加 UAC list 很有帮助,因为它指定了如何在我的应用程序中实现权限 (http://msdn.microsoft.com/en-us/library/bb756929.aspx)。

//关闭

关于c# - 成为 "the real administrator"(Windows) 并在 .NET C# 中执行真正的管理任务?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5700889/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com